I have a 17' silverline open bow with the 2.3 omc outdrive. Just a little background...I bought the boat with a cracked head, the boat has set from last summer too now. I fixed the head problem.It starts and idels great but sputters and cut out at rpms anywhere above 3000 I can try too accelerate but it wont, I can pull the throttle back and it smooths out again,I run it at home with the muffs on and it runs fine at any rpm. So far I have set the timing, dwell, and points to specs, changed fuel filter, put fresh gas in it, took carb apart and blew jets out and ports, new spark plugs and wires. Could my problem be in the coil, or maybe the carb, or neither. <br /><br /><br /> Any help would be greatly appreciated

Re: omc 2.3 sputters at 3000 rpms

How did you fix the head problem? Assuming you replaced the head did you replace it with a new or reconditioned one or did you just get another second hand head and fit it? Lots of things can cause your problem and it may have nothing to do with the work you have done or it may be directly related to what you have done. On the face of it I will say you may have a vacuum leak causing a fuel starvation problem, this is usual if the engine with free rev but will not pull under load. Other causes include incorrectly adjusted valves, poor fuel pressure or a low adjusted float level. Have you checked the cap and rotor for wear? If you can get hold of a vacuum gauge that will often lead you to the cause.
